How the Career System Works

Paralives replaces the traditional career ladder with a flexible, skill-based Application Points system. Instead of simply showing up to work and waiting for a promotion clock to tick down, your career success depends on your Parafolk's actual skills, mood, relationships, and daily performance.

The system rewards intentional gameplay: building the right skills, maintaining good relationships with colleagues, keeping your Parafolk happy, and making strategic choices about work schedules and job perks.

Upgrade Points & Promotions

Paralives uses a unique Upgrade Points system for career advancement:

  1. Attend work regularly (arrive on time, meet daily goals, stay focused)
  2. Earn Upgrade Points at the end of each workday
  3. Spend Upgrade Points in the career menu to level up
  4. When you level up, you receive 3 cards:
    • 1 Career Advancement Card: Permanently raises your job rank
    • 2 Job Perk Cards: Choose 1 to add to your 3-slot perk bar

This system gives you meaningful choices at every promotion. The two perk cards let you customize your career path — choose perks that match your playstyle rather than being locked into a single progression.

Career Building Tips

  1. Build relevant skills before applying. Check the job requirements, then spend a few in-game days practicing those skills at home. A skill check that seems daunting becomes easy with minimal practice.
  2. Maintain positive mood at work. A happy Parafolk performs better. Satisfy needs before heading to work, and avoid scheduling work when exhaustion or hunger is critical.
  3. Cultivate coworker relationships. Positive relationships with colleagues and managers directly boost your daily performance evaluation. Consider befriending your boss.
  4. Customize your schedule from day one. Don't accept the default schedule. Set work hours that leave time for skills, relationships, and personal projects.
  5. Choose perks deliberately. At each promotion, think about your long-term goals. A perk that boosts income is good; one that enables skill practice while working is better for long-term progression.
  6. Consider a second job later. Once established in one career, some Parafolks can take a second part-time job in a different field for extra income and skill variety.
  7. Use Town Events for networking. Some careers have coworkers who attend specific Town Events. Building relationships there can lead to workplace opportunities.

Frequently Asked Questions

How many jobs are in Paralives?
126 jobs across 22 companies and 11 career domains: Art, Business, Culinary, Education, Entertainment, Medical, Politics, Science, Service, Sports, Technology.
What is the highest-paying job?
CEO at ClickWork Industries at $2,100/day. Other top earners include senior Technology and Medical positions. Pay = base + rank + skill bonuses ($15/day per relevant skill level + combo bonus).
Can I change careers?
Yes, quit and apply for new jobs anytime. Career perks from previous jobs are retained permanently — they're passive bonuses that stay even after leaving the job.
